Performance
The core difference lies in the chipsets. The Honor Magic6 Pro’s Snapdragon 8 Gen 3 (4nm) is a proven performer, known for its balance of power and efficiency. The Xiaomi 15S Pro’s Xring O1 (3nm) *could* theoretically offer superior efficiency due to the smaller node size, but real-world performance will depend heavily on architecture and thermal management. The Xring O1’s 10-core configuration (2x3.9GHz Cortex-X925, 4x3.4GHz Cortex-A725, 2x1.9GHz Cortex-A725, 2x1.8GHz Cortex-A520) is complex, potentially leading to scheduling overhead. The Honor’s octa-core setup (1x3.3 GHz Cortex-X4, 3x3.2 GHz Cortex-A720, 2x3.0 GHz Cortex-A720, 2x2.3 GHz Cortex-A520) is more streamlined. The Snapdragon 8 Gen 3’s Adreno GPU is also a known quantity, while the Xring O1’s GPU performance is unknown. The Honor’s LPDDR5x RAM will contribute to faster data access.
Battery Life
The Honor Magic6 Pro’s 14:06h active use score is a significant advantage, demonstrating excellent battery life. While the Xiaomi 15S Pro’s battery capacity is unknown, the Honor’s score suggests superior power efficiency. The Xiaomi offers faster charging at 90W wired and 50W wireless, compared to the Honor’s 80W wired and 66W wireless. This means the Xiaomi can replenish its battery more quickly, but the Honor’s longer battery life may negate the need for frequent charging. The 10W reverse wireless charging on the Xiaomi is also faster than the Honor’s reverse wireless/5W reverse wired options.
